Aaron Cates 1798–1876 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 4 April 1798

Birth Location: Orange County, North Carolina, USA

Death Date: 18 May 1876

Death Location: Orange County, North Carolina, USA

Father: Isaiah Cates

Mother: Jane Daniel

Spouse(s): Nancy Andrews

Children(s): William Cates

Aaron Cates was born in 1798 in Orange County, North Carolina, USA, the child of Isaiah Cates And Jane O Daniel. Aaron Cates married Nancy Andrews, and had children including William Aaron Cates. Aaron Cates passed away in 1876 in Orange County, North Carolina, USA.
